How to Read a Thermometer Worksheet: A Step by Step Guide

Step 1: Prepare the Thermometer
Before you begin reading a thermometer, make sure that you have the correct type of thermometer for the task. Make sure that the thermometer is clean, that it is in good working order and that the mercury is at room temperature. If the thermometer is a mercury thermometer, be sure to shake it down to ensure that the mercury is below the scale before you begin.

Step 2: Read the Scale
The thermometer scale, or range, should be clearly visible on the side or stem of the thermometer. It could be represented in either Celsius or Fahrenheit, depending on the type of thermometer. Read the scale to determine the range of temperatures that the thermometer is capable of measuring.

Step 3: Determine the Temperature
Locate the end of the mercury column or the digital indicator and note the temperature that is shown. This number is the temperature of the object or environment being measured.

Step 4: Check Accuracy
If possible, compare the thermometer reading with another thermometer to make sure that it is accurate. If the two readings are not within a few degrees of each other, recalibrate the thermometer or check for other sources of error.

Step 5: Record the Temperature
Once you have determined the temperature, record the reading in a notebook or other appropriate format. Make sure to include the date and time of the reading, as well as any additional information that may be relevant.
